A patient fell two weeks ago, striking their head. Today, the patient presented with a persistent headache

and nausea and was diagnosed with a small subdural hematoma. The patient has been in the ED for

24 hours awaiting an inpatient bed. The night shift

nurse reports the patient has been anxious, restless,

shaky, and vomited twice during the night.The patient

states they couldn't sleep because a young child kept

coming into the room. What is the most likely cause

for these signs and symptoms?

a. increase intracranial pressure

b. alcohol withdrawal

c. rhabdomyolysis

d. pulmonary embolus

2. Treatment for frostbite can include which of the following interventions?

a. warm the affected part over 30-60 minutes

b. use gentle friction to improve circulation

c. administer tissue plasminogen activator

d. leave all of the blisters intact

3. A patient with a spinal cord injury at C5 is being

cared for in the emergency department while awaiting

transport to a trauma center. Which of the following

represents the highest priority for ongoing assessment and management for this patient?

a. maintain adequate respiratory status.

b. administer balanced resuscitation fluid

c. perform serial assessments of neurologic function

d. maintain core temperature

4. Following a bomb explosion, fragmentation injuries

from the bomb or objects in the environment are examples of which phase of injury?

a. primary

b. secondary

c. tertiary

d. quaternary
